** The Jeep repair and modification market in the Johnsonburg area is representative of a rural Pennsylvania community with strong outdoor recreation traditions. The market is not saturated with national chains specializing in Jeeps; instead, it is dominated by a handful of highly competent, locally-owned shops and garages that have earned community trust over decades. The quality of service is generally high, with a focus on practical, durable repairs suited for the local terrain and climate. **Competition Level:** Moderate. While there aren't dozens of options, the existing providers are established and compete on reputation, specialized knowledge, and personalized service rather than price alone. Customers tend to be loyal to shops that demonstrate proven expertise with the complex 4x4 systems found in modern Wranglers and Gladiators. **Typical Pricing:** Pricing is competitive with regional averages. Labor rates typically range from **$90 - $130 per hour**. For specialized services like a full suspension lift kit installation (parts and labor), customers can expect to invest **$2,500 - $5,000+**, depending on the kit's complexity and quality. Engine and transmission work is a significant investment, often starting at several thousand dollars. The local shops provide fair value, focusing on correct, long-lasting repairs rather than being the lowest-cost option.
